Output 63622bcc09e029b2a72a1fa5cad33c71e8359df05fa2c319feea18feb3ea5749:19

value
3268000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97de7de985d795ae9b6131d8eed93bffd13c381e OP_EQUAL
address
A6HHEMrzdPS6DtMRuCcnGqiN5JbTxFLck8
transaction
63622bcc09e029b2a72a1fa5cad33c71e8359df05fa2c319feea18feb3ea5749